What is Jenkins Training for Continuous Integration?

The Jenkins Training for Continuous Integration Course equips professionals with essential skills to streamline software development and delivery processes. Jenkins is a key tool in the DevOps ecosystem, making this training vital for anyone involved in software development, system administration, or quality assurance. Mastering Jenkins helps organisations deliver high-quality software faster and more reliably, which is crucial in today’s fast-paced IT industry.

Proficiency in Jenkins empowers professionals to automate and accelerate software development, ensuring efficient and reliable releases. This course is ideal for DevOps Engineers, Software Developers, System Administrators, and Quality Assurance Professionals looking to enhance their DevOps skills and remain competitive in the evolving IT landscape. Mastering Jenkins is essential for professionals aiming to excel in managing continuous integration and delivery pipelines effectively.

Oakwood International’s 1-day Jenkins Continuous Integration Course offers delegates an in-depth understanding of Jenkins server configuration and the setup of continuous integration tools. Delegates will learn how to configure Jenkins servers, create pipelines, and manage automated builds and tests. Delivered by experienced instructors, the course ensures that delegates acquire hands-on skills to implement Jenkins in their organisations, optimising software development workflows.
 

Course Objectives:
 

  • To learn how to install, set up, and configure Jenkins pipelines
  • To manage and maintain building, testing, and developing enterprise software projects
  • To distinguish between Jenkins declarative and scripted pipelines
  • To understand how to integrate and use third-party build tools with the Jenkins pipeline
  • To use Jenkins to generate Java coding standards reports and code coverage reports
  • To become familiar with configuring the system environment and global properties

After completing this Jenkins Continuous Integration Course, delegates will possess a solid foundation in Jenkins and continuous integration practices. They will be well-prepared to pursue DevOps Certifications and apply their knowledge in real-world scenarios, improving software development processes and contributing to their organisation’s success.

Course Outline

Jenkins Training for Continuous Integration

Module 1: Introduction to Jenkins 

  • Continuous Integration Fundamentals
  • Overview of Jenkins
  • Continuous Integration into the Organisation 
     

Module 2: Jenkins Installation 

  • Steps of Jenkins installation
     

Module 3: Get Start with Jenkins 

  • Steps to Start with Jenkins 
     

Module 4: Configuring Jenkins Server 

  • Configuring
    • Dashboard
    • System Environment and Global Properties
    • JDKs
    • Build Tools
    • Mail Server and Proxy 
       

Module 5: Setting Up Build Jobs 

  • Jenkins Build Jobs
  • Create a Freestyle Build Job
  • Installing Git Plugin for Jenkins 
     

Module 6: Overview of Automated Testing 

  • Introduction to Automated Testing
  • Create New Job for Unit Testing 
     

Module 7: Introduction to Notification and Code Quality 

  • Notification
  • Code Quality 
     

Module 8: Advanced Build and Distributed Builds 

  • Advanced Build
  • Distributed Builds 
     

Module 9: Maintaining Jenkins 

  • Monitoring Disk Space
  • Backing Up the Configuration
  • Archiving and Retrieving Build Jobs

Included

Included

  • No course includes are available.

Offered In This Course:

  • vedio Video Content
  • elearning eLearning Materials
  • exam Study Resources
  • certificate Completion Certificate
  • study Tutor Support
  • workbook Interactive Quizzes
Individual Training

Individual Training fosters personal growth, enhances professional skills, and builds confidence.

Get a Quote rightblue-arrow
Corporate Training

Corporate Training improves employee skills, increases productivity, and aligns teams with company objectives.

Learning Options

Discover a range of flexible learning options designed to meet your needs. Select the format that best supports your personal growth and goals.

Online Instructor-Led Training

  • Live virtual classes led by experienced trainers, offering real-time interaction and guidance for optimal learning outcomes.

Online Self-Paced Training

  • Flexible learning at your own pace, with access to comprehensive course materials and resources available anytime, anywhere.

Build your future with Oakwood International

We empower you with the skills, knowledge, and confidence to excel in your career. Join us and take the first step towards realising your professional goals.

Frequently Asked Questions

Q. What is the focus of the Jenkins Continuous Integration Course?

The course focuses on automating software builds, testing, and deployment processes using Jenkins, enabling efficient and reliable software delivery.

Q. Who is this course ideal for?

This course is ideal for DevOps Engineers, Software Developers, System Administrators, and Quality Assurance Professionals aiming to enhance their continuous integration and deployment skills.

Q. What skills will I gain from this training?

Delegates will learn to configure Jenkins, create and manage pipelines, automate builds, and integrate third-party tools to streamline software development processes.

Q. How is the training delivered?

The course is delivered through interactive sessions, including hands-on exercises and real-world examples, providing a practical understanding of Jenkins.

Q. What are the career benefits of this certification?

This certification boosts your ability to implement Jenkins effectively, enhancing your career prospects in DevOps, software development, and IT operations roles.

Didn’t Find What You’re Looking For?